The IT Apps Designer is responsible for designing, developing, testing, and implementing application software, including client, server, and middleware. This role involves creating software designs at the component level based on application architecture and detailed business requirements, as well as designing and building algorithms and data structures. The position also includes responsibilities for application performance monitoring and tuning, developing strategies for monitoring, preventive maintenance, and disaster recovery of applications, and serving as a technical expert in at least one application within a portfolio. The IT Apps Designer will ensure that solution designs meet requirements for scalability, performance, and quality in accordance with negotiated service level agreements, and will participate in the assessment and resolution of software defects. Additionally, this role will assist project management with work breakdown structures, project plans, and skills required for application development and implementation, and participate in design reviews and technical evaluations. The IT Apps Designer will also be involved in the review, business case development, and implementation of software development tools, methodologies, and standards, and must understand IS Security measures and current standards, practices, and technology. The role may also involve serving as a liaison with suppliers for sustaining activities, assisting with the evaluation and recommendations for purchased software packages and supporting services, and mentoring junior staff on building and maintaining application systems. Other duties as assigned.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level